Dr Stephen Mullin is an Associate Professor of Neurology at the University of Plymouth and consultant neurologist. He has a background of neurogenetics in Parkinson’s disease. Increasingly his research is focussed on the use of advanced bioinformatics and artificial intelligence to improve clinical care and answer research questions using routinely collected medical data. Particular interests include use of such data to prevent disease, augment patient safety and deliver better more inclusive clinical trials.’
